An Apparent Connection between Histidine, Recombination, and Repair in Neurospora
Authors:Dorothy Newmeyer  Alice L Schroeder  and Donna R Galeazzi
Institution:Department of Biological Sciences, Stanford University, Stanford, California 94305;Program in Genetics, Washington State University, Pullman, Washington 99163
Abstract:Two mutants of Neurospora crassa, uvs-3 and mei-3, share four properties--UV sensitivity, inhibition by histidine, meiotic blockage when homozygous, and increased duplication instability (due to mitotic crossing over, to deletions or to both). The present paper shows that a third nonallelic mutant, uvs-6, exhibits the same four properties.--Also, the instability of duplications in the absence of any UV-sensitive mutant is increased by the presence of histidine in the growth medium.
